Page MenuHomePhabricator

Traffic Server - Prometheus integration
Closed, ResolvedPublic

Description

trafficserver_exporter uses the stats_over_http ATS plugin to translate JSON data into Prometheus format.

We should:

  • enable stats_over_http
  • package and deploy trafficserver_exporter
  • add the aggregation rules that make sense

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ript
ema triaged this task as Medium priority.Aug 21 2018, 11:55 AM
ema updated the task description. (Show Details)

Mentioned in SAL (#wikimedia-operations) [2018-08-22T16:21:09Z] <ema> prometheus-trafficserver-exporter 0.0.2-1 uploaded to stretch-wikimedia T202381

Change 454766 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] prometheus: add trafficserver_exporter

https://gerrit.wikimedia.org/r/454766

Change 454766 merged by Ema:
[operations/puppet@production] prometheus: add trafficserver_exporter

https://gerrit.wikimedia.org/r/454766

Change 454784 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] prometheus: Job definition for trafficserver_exporter

https://gerrit.wikimedia.org/r/454784

Change 454784 merged by Ema:
[operations/puppet@production] prometheus: Job definition for trafficserver_exporter

https://gerrit.wikimedia.org/r/454784

Change 465172 had a related patch set uploaded (by Ema; owner: Ema):
[operations/puppet@production] prometheus: ATS aggregation rules

https://gerrit.wikimedia.org/r/465172

Change 465172 merged by Ema:
[operations/puppet@production] prometheus: ATS aggregation rules

https://gerrit.wikimedia.org/r/465172

ema updated the task description. (Show Details)